Transaction 44c566223ea118274631f84ce37ac95e004b23a3f671235ed6378abb4aa22c72
1 Input
1 Output
-
44c566223ea118274631f84ce37ac95e004b23a3f671235ed6378abb4aa22c72:0
- value
- 150697146
- script pubkey
- OP_0 OP_PUSHBYTES_20 10e38acd71a9e749cbb1db263680c410ab4bf4d9
- address
- bc1qzr3c4nt348n5nja3mvnrdqxyzz45haxetzkqwa